A former lode Au mine located in the W½ (estimated) (lot 37) sec. 29, T4N, R12E, MDM, 1.0 km (0.6 mile) NNW of Kentucky House and 2.9 km (9,400 feet) S of San Andreas. Operated in the 1860's but work ceased in 1884. Reopened in 1916 and worked intermittently until the 1930's. MRDS database stated accuracy for this location is 1,000 meters.
Mineralization is a vein deposit hosted in greenstone and slate. The ore body strikes NW and dips NE. The vein isd 5 feet thick with 40 feet of gouge on the hanging walln and a greenstone footwall. The footwall is a dike of chloritic felsite and the hanging wall is serpentine . Local rocks include Paleozoic marine rocks, undivided, unit 4 (Western Sierra Nevada) and/or Jurassic marine rocks, unit 1 (Western Sierra Nevada and Western Klamath Mountains).
Workings include underground openings with an overall depth of 126.49 meters. The workings have been extended laterally and in depth for at least two periods. Early in 1931 a vertical shaft was extended to a depth of 415 feet. The 200 level was run for 125 feet. Then 350 level was 230 feet long, and the 500 foot level had been run 60 feet. Recent development work (1930's) was disappointing.
Production data are found in: Logan, Clarence August and Franke, H. (1934).
Production in 1928 averaged $2 (period values) ton/Au. Sampling in the 1930's indicated that the grade is too low to warrant production.
